An elevation sling is designed with both strength and flexibility in mind, crafted from high-grade materials like polyester or nylon. These materials offer pivotal advantages they are lightweight, resistant to moisture and chemical exposure, and flexible enough to minimize damage to the load being transported. Expert users appreciate the versatile nature of these slings, as they can adapt to a variety of load shapes and sizes, maintaining their integrity under significant stress. The importance of proper training cannot be overstated
. Users of elevation slings regularly undergo extensive training, ensuring that they are not only aware of the mechanical aspects but also the safety protocols associated with their use. It's about developing a mental checklist that includes inspecting slings for wear and tear, understanding load limits, and ensuring slings are stored appropriately to extend their life. Integrating modern technology, such as RFID tagging and smart sensors, into lifting equipment, including elevation slings, represents another leap in credibility and dependable use. This innovation allows real-time tracking of sling conditions, alerting users to potential risks before they materialize into critical failures. Technology-driven solutions not only enhance safety but also streamline inventory management and reduce operational downtimes.
